Output d596cac8e7cfcb607d2226e69eedba82aea940e6a13bca0bb3d00c6eea35fac8:0

value
407564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a8bd4a7df64697490ce75a2e20825227293f40 OP_EQUAL
address
3KcrWMzkaRoRej8cdrx3ZnjEmvJLp14t6y
transaction
d596cac8e7cfcb607d2226e69eedba82aea940e6a13bca0bb3d00c6eea35fac8
spent
true